+lib/libc/net/getaddrinfo.c                     1.98 - 1.100
+include/netdb.h                                        1.65
+       Add AI_ADDRCONFIG, which makes getaddrinfo() return only address with
+       families that are already configured in the system.
+       [khorben, ticket #278]

+sys/arch/i386/stand/lib/exec.c                 1.50
+sys/arch/sandpoint/stand/altboot/main.c                1.21 via patch
+sys/lib/libsa/ext2fs.c                         1.13
+sys/lib/libsa/ffsv1.c                          1.6
+sys/lib/libsa/ffsv2.c                          1.6
+sys/lib/libsa/globals.c                                1.9
+sys/lib/libsa/lfsv1.c                          1.5
+sys/lib/libsa/lfsv2.c                          1.5
+sys/lib/libsa/stand.h                          1.76
+sys/lib/libsa/ufs.c                            1.58
+       Remove the code that tries to load the "ffs" kernel module during boot.
+       This is in line with the core decision than even modular kernels should
+       contain the ffs code.
+       I've left in the code that tries to load "nfs" and "ext2fs", but it
+       isn't clear that is necessary.
+       Removes a warning message that (usually) flashes past to fast to read.
+       AFAICT all the relevant kernels contain ffs (and nfs for that matter).
+       [dsl, ticket #279]

+sys/arch/amd64/include/frameasm.h              1.17-1.19
+sys/arch/amd64/amd64/vector.S                  1.40-1.41
+sys/arch/amd64/amd64/trap.c                    1.71
+       Fix issues when amd64 manages to trap during 'return to user'.  ie on
+       the 'iret' or while loading segment registers.
+       Also detects any fault loading %gs and re-instates the kernel gs_base
+       value before entering the trap handler.
+       [dsl, ticket #280]
